El Paraíso (Spanish pronunciation: [el paɾaˈiso]) is a town, with a population of 26,640 (2020 calculation),[2] and a municipality in the Honduran department of El Paraíso.
The town is the site of a cigar factory operated by Nestor Plasencia, in which cigars are made under a variety of labels, including that of Rocky Patel.
